Think Tank Scholar 100+ Second Grade Sight Words Flash Cards are expertly curated from Dolch and Fry lists to cover up to 75% of words found in beginner books for ages 7-8. Featuring 54 durable, double-sided cards with large bold print and rounded edges, these award-winning flash cards include 6 teaching methods and 6 fun games to boost reading fluency, accuracy, and comprehension. Made from eco-friendly materials, they provide a proven, engaging way to accelerate second grade reading skills.

These cards are great and a lot has been learnt from them. However, the text itself is a bit confusing. The lower case "a" my daughter has become familiar with isn't like the one like on the cards but like this text. Also, the word & capital letter "I" just looks like an "l" on a card to a young reader. It also doesn't look like the capital letter she is familiar with! Perhaps a different text type would've been beneficial for these.

Love these cards!!! I’m always driving my kids around to a lot of activities and I was looking for something they could do in the car besides staring at a screen. They have a bunch of suggested games which I found handy. The “phonic hunt” game suggestion is a fun drive time game. “Slapjack” is also good, if you have a bench seat. I like that cards show usage of the words in sentences, so kids can practice. The box is very sturdy and a fantastic feature considering our use-on-the-go. We have had decks in the past where the paper case is torn like on the first day we opened them. Because the kids trash everything. Cards are a good quality, nice weight to them and size. They have a nice finish. They look like they could stand up to spilled chocolate milk. I like the prefix and suffix cards, very educational that I didn’t see elsewhere with other products so that was cool. Artwork and coloring is lovely too. Driving to games and practices with two kids I figure there’s easily 10 minutes in the car 4-5 days a week for something educational that’s gotta add up!! Very pleased and highly recommend.
